30. Planetary Gears and Output Shaft Installation

^ Tools Required
- J 36850 Transjel(TM) Transmission Assembly Lubricant





1. Install the output shaft thrust bearing and race (1) to the transmission case.
2. Lubricate the thrust bearing and race with J 36850.





3. Install the brake applying tube (1) and leaf spring (3) to the transmission case. Align the tube lug (2) with the cutout in the case (4).





4. Install the planetary gear/output shaft (1) together to the transmission case.
5. Install the reverse brake plates and discs in the following order:
5.1. The plate
5.2. The disc
5.3. The plate
5.4. The disc
5.5. The plate
5.6. The disc
5.7. The plate
5.8. The disc





6. Measure the reverse brake plate-to-transmission case lug clearance:
6.1. Take the measurement:
^ Reverse brake plate-to-transmission case lug clearance (standard): 0.72-2.50 mm (0.029-0.098 inch)
6.2. If clearance is less than the specification, perform the following steps:
^ Inspect for proper installation.
^ Inspect for dust or fluid on the reverse brake disc.
6.3. If clearance is more than the specification, replace one of the following components:
^ The reverse brake disc
^ The reverse brake plate
^ The reverse backing plate
7. Install the reverse brake reaction plate to the transmission case.





8. Align the notch in the reverse brake reaction plate with the leaf spring (1).





9. Install the snap ring (1) to the front of the reverse brake reaction plate (2).
